The hexadecimal color code #EEAC96 corresponds to the code RGB( 238, 172, 150 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,93 level), green (at 0,67 level) and blue (at 0,59 level). Its brightness is 76% and its saturation is 72%. It is composed of red at 42%, green at 30% and blue at 26%.

Uses of #EEAC96 in CSS

When using #EEAC96 as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#EEAC96 as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
